Duchess Olga Romanova
Nov. 30, 2024
Grand Duchess Olga Alexandrovna of Russia - Wikipedia Grand Duchess Olga Nikolaevna of Russia - Wikipedia Grand Duchess Olga Nikolaevna of Russia - Wikipedia Grand Duchess Olga Nikolaevna of Russia - Wikipedia OLGA ROMANOV: GRAND DUCHESS OLGA NIKOLAEVNA OF RUSSIA – The Romanov Family Grand Duchess Olga Alexandrovna of Russia - Simple English Wikipedia, the free encyclopedia | Duchess Olga Romanova